dc.description.abstract The low-K Fra Mauro (LKFM) basalt composition is common among the melt breccias sampled by the Apollo missions to the lunar highlands. We analyzed major and minor elements in mineral clasts in the lunar LKFM impact melts 15445 and 15455, which may represent Imbrium Basin impact melt, to determine their provenance. en
